Royal Couple To Meet In Bahamas
(N.Z.P. A. -Reuter—Copyright)
TOKYO, Feb. 27. Lord Snowdon, sporting a beard of several weeks’ growth, left Tokyo secretly yesterday to join Princess Margaret on holiday in the Bahamas.
An interview with Lord Snowdon was shown on a Japanese television network today. The commentator said that the beard was a disguise to shield him from publicity during his photographic assignment in Japan for the “Sunday Times.” Lord Snowdon spent several weeks in Tokyo under a false name and revealed himself for the first time yesterday when he recorded the television interview. Lord Snowdon’s beard was evidently a striking success since he escaped unnoticed for 25 days in spite of eager investigations by Japanese reporters assigned to track him down. It is believed that he
brought forward his departure from today to yesterday because the press seemed to be too close. An airline said today that it still had a booking in his name on a flight this afternoon to Seattle.
